Youth Corps Opens for the Summer in NYC
The Youth Corps season is open in New York City and applications are now available, a Brooklyn lawmaker announced Sunday.
Councilman Chaim Deutsch said that forms for the 2016 Summer Youth Employment Program are available on the NYC Department of Youth & Community Development website to be filled out online, or at community-based organizations.
The deadline to apply is April 15. Participants of the program are selected by lottery. Those with additional questions about SYEP can call Councilman Deutsch’s office at 718-368-9176.
The program provides New York City youths between the ages of 14 and 24 with paid summer employment for up to 25 hours per week for six weeks in July and August, giving them the chance to earn wages during their months off from school.
Workers will be paid the 2016 minimum hourly wage of $9.00.
The program also offers training workshops in job readiness, financial literacy and opportunities for participants to continue their education.
